@@ -228,10 +281,10 @@ E.onDOMReady(function(e){
};
var dataset = dataset;
var overview_dataset = [overview_dataset];
- var choiceContainer = YAHOO.util.Dom.get("legend_choices");
- var choiceContainerTable = YAHOO.util.Dom.get("legend_choices_tables");
- var plotContainer = YAHOO.util.Dom.get('commit_history');
- var overviewContainer = YAHOO.util.Dom.get('overview');
+ var choiceContainer = YUD.get("legend_choices");
+ var choiceContainerTable = YUD.get("legend_choices_tables");
+ var plotContainer = YUD.get('commit_history');
+ var overviewContainer = YUD.get('overview');
var plot_options = {
bars: {show:true,align:'center',lineWidth:4},
@@ -257,7 +310,7 @@ E.onDOMReady(function(e){
bars: {show:true,barWidth: 2,},
shadowSize: 0,
xaxis: {mode: "time", timeformat: "%d/%m/%y",},
- yaxis: {ticks: 3, min: 0,},
+ yaxis: {ticks: 3, min: 0,tickDecimals:0,},
grid: {color: "#999",},
selection: {mode: "x"}
};
@@ -314,7 +367,7 @@ E.onDOMReady(function(e){
div.style.backgroundColor='#fee';
document.body.appendChild(div);
}
- YAHOO.util.Dom.setStyle(div, 'opacity', 0);
+ YUD.setStyle(div, 'opacity', 0);
div.innerHTML = contents;
div.style.top=(y + 5) + "px";
div.style.left=(x + 5) + "px";
@@ -324,9 +377,9 @@ E.onDOMReady(function(e){
}
/**
- * This function will detect if selected period has some changesets for this user
- if it does this data is then pushed for displaying
- Additionally it will only display users that are selected by the checkbox
+ * This function will detect if selected period has some changesets
+ for this user if it does this data is then pushed for displaying
+ Additionally it will only display users that are selected by the checkbox
*/
function getDataAccordingToRanges(ranges) {
@@ -334,31 +387,28 @@ E.onDOMReady(function(e){
var keys = [];
for(var key in dataset){
var push = false;
+
//method1 slow !!
- ///*
+ //*
for(var ds in dataset[key].data){
commit_data = dataset[key].data[ds];
- //console.log(key);
- //console.log(new Date(commit_data.time*1000));
- //console.log(new Date(ranges.xaxis.from*1000));
- //console.log(new Date(ranges.xaxis.to*1000));
if (commit_data.time >= ranges.xaxis.from && commit_data.time <= ranges.xaxis.to){
push = true;
break;
}
}
- //*/
+ //*/
+
/*//method2 sorted commit data !!!
+
var first_commit = dataset[key].data[0].time;
var last_commit = dataset[key].data[dataset[key].data.length-1].time;
- console.log(first_commit);
- console.log(last_commit);
-
if (first_commit >= ranges.xaxis.from && last_commit <= ranges.xaxis.to){
push = true;
}
- */
+ //*/
+
if(push){
data.push(dataset[key]);
}
@@ -399,14 +449,14 @@ E.onDOMReady(function(e){
new_data.push(getDummyData(checkbox_key));
}
}
-
+
var new_options = YAHOO.lang.merge(plot_options, {
xaxis: {
min: cur_ranges.xaxis.from,
max: cur_ranges.xaxis.to,
mode:"time",
timeformat: "%d/%m",
- }
+ },
});
if (!new_data){
new_data = [[0,1]];
@@ -440,7 +490,12 @@ E.onDOMReady(function(e){
max: ranges.xaxis.to,
mode:"time",
timeformat: "%d/%m",
- }
+ },
+ yaxis: {
+ min: ranges.yaxis.from,
+ max: ranges.yaxis.to,
+ },
+
});
// do the zooming
plot = YAHOO.widget.Flot(plotContainer, data, new_options);
@@ -454,7 +509,7 @@ E.onDOMReady(function(e){
overview.setSelection(ranges, true);
//resubscribe choiced
- YAHOO.util.Event.on(choiceContainer.getElementsByTagName("input"), "click", plotchoiced, [data, ranges]);
+ YUE.on(choiceContainer.getElementsByTagName("input"), "click", plotchoiced, [data, ranges]);
}
var previousPoint = null;
@@ -463,13 +518,13 @@ E.onDOMReady(function(e){
var pos = o.pos;
var item = o.item;
- //YAHOO.util.Dom.get("x").innerHTML = pos.x.toFixed(2);
- //YAHOO.util.Dom.get("y").innerHTML = pos.y.toFixed(2);
+ //YUD.get("x").innerHTML = pos.x.toFixed(2);
+ //YUD.get("y").innerHTML = pos.y.toFixed(2);
if (item) {
if (previousPoint != item.datapoint) {
previousPoint = item.datapoint;
- var tooltip = YAHOO.util.Dom.get("tooltip");
+ var tooltip = YUD.get("tooltip");
if(tooltip) {
tooltip.parentNode.removeChild(tooltip);
}
@@ -508,7 +563,7 @@ E.onDOMReady(function(e){
}
}
else {
- var tooltip = YAHOO.util.Dom.get("tooltip");
+ var tooltip = YUD.get("tooltip");
if(tooltip) {
tooltip.parentNode.removeChild(tooltip);
@@ -541,7 +596,7 @@ E.onDOMReady(function(e){
plot.subscribe("plothover", plothover);
- YAHOO.util.Event.on(choiceContainer.getElementsByTagName("input"), "click", plotchoiced, [data, initial_ranges]);
+ YUE.on(choiceContainer.getElementsByTagName("input"), "click", plotchoiced, [data, initial_ranges]);
}
SummaryPlot(${c.ts_min},${c.ts_max},${c.commit_data|n},${c.overview_data|n});
@@ -551,18 +606,20 @@ E.onDOMReady(function(e){
-
${h.link_to(_('Last ten changes'),h.url('changelog_home',repo_name=c.repo_name))}
+
${h.link_to(_('Shortlog'),h.url('shortlog_home',repo_name=c.repo_name))}
- <%include file='../shortlog/shortlog_data.html'/>
- %if c.repo_changesets:
- ${h.link_to(_('show more'),h.url('changelog_home',repo_name=c.repo_name))}
- %endif
+
+ <%include file='../shortlog/shortlog_data.html'/>
+
+ ##%if c.repo_changesets:
+ ## ${h.link_to(_('show more'),h.url('changelog_home',repo_name=c.repo_name))}
+ ##%endif
-
${h.link_to(_('Last ten tags'),h.url('tags_home',repo_name=c.repo_name))}
+
${h.link_to(_('Tags'),h.url('tags_home',repo_name=c.repo_name))}
<%include file='../tags/tags_data.html'/>
@@ -573,7 +630,7 @@ E.onDOMReady(function(e){
-
${h.link_to(_('Last ten branches'),h.url('branches_home',repo_name=c.repo_name))}
+
${h.link_to(_('Branches'),h.url('branches_home',repo_name=c.repo_name))}
<%include file='../branches/branches_data.html'/>